Xhanfise (Çipi) Keko

Lexo ngjarje:

Xhanfise (Çipi) Keko, a film director specializing in children’s films and People’s Artist, passed away. She was born in Gjirokastër in 1928. She studied film editing in Moscow. Her career evolved over the years, transitioning into directing beloved films that prominently featured children as main actors. Her husband, the documentary filmmaker Endri Keko, was a supportive figure in her career. Despite being produced under the guise of propaganda, her films served as a window to escape the political pressures of the time and offered not only children but also parents a model for child education. Many of her films were inspired by Albania’s past, especially during the period of Nazi occupation and the impact it left on the collective memory of children. (In the photo: Xhanfise (Chipi) Keko)
